The Itinerary Breakdown: What You’ll Experience

This private tour offers a thoughtfully designed route that balances scenic drives with stops that invite exploration. Starting from Zurich, your driver will pick you up and whisk you into the beautiful Bernese Oberland. The first stop is Interlaken, a town famous for its dramatic location between Lake Brienz and Lake Thun. Here, you have about two hours to enjoy the vistas and perhaps take a boat ride on Lake Thun. You might also enjoy a scenic train ride connecting different Swiss villages, which adds a layer of variety to the day.

Interlaken is a highlight partly because of its unique setting and lively atmosphere. One reviewer appreciated the “knowledgeable” driver who gave good recommendations for taking photos, making this a memorable start. The small town offers lovely views of the surrounding mountains, and if you’re a fan of lakes and water activities, this is a perfect spot for a quick boat ride.

Next, you’ll head to Grindelwald. You have about 1.5 hours here, which might seem brief, but it’s enough to stroll along its cobblestone streets, admire mountain views of Eiger, Mönch, and Jungfrau, and perhaps visit a local museum or church. Some travelers find Grindelwald a highlight due to its “stunning scenery” and charming atmosphere. An optional train ride or continuing by car allows you flexibility, but the key is to soak in the mountain vistas and rustic chalets.

Then, the tour takes you to Lauterbrunnen, often called one of the most beautiful valleys in Switzerland. You’ll get around 90 minutes to explore this lush, waterfall-laden landscape. The Statue of waterfalls and the surrounding villages are postcard-perfect, and many find Lauterbrunnen to be a peaceful, awe-inspiring stop. The scenic waterfalls, including Trümmelbach and Staubbach, are often described as breathtaking, providing perfect photo opportunities.

Finally, the return to Zurich involves a panorama drive through the Bernese Oberland, allowing you to reflect on the day’s sights while enjoying impressive mountain views from the comfort of your private vehicle.

Some Drawbacks and Considerations

A few reviews pointed out potential issues, primarily about the vehicle size. One reviewer noted the car was a Toyota Prius XL, which was “really made for 4 passengers max” and had a body advertisement that obstructed views from the back windows. For those traveling with mobility challenges, this could be an issue since the vehicle might be small and not very accessible.

Weather can also be a factor—many of the best views depend on having clear skies. Rain or fog can obscure the mountains and waterfalls, turning what should be a dazzling sight into a more subdued experience.

Lastly, some travelers felt that the touring information was somewhat limited, with the driver mainly providing transportation rather than detailed commentary about each site. If you’re seeking in-depth historical or cultural insights, you might want to prepare some questions or plan for additional guided options.
